summaryrefslogtreecommitdiffstats
path: root/llvm/lib/CodeGen/MachineFunctionAnalysis.cpp
diff options
context:
space:
mode:
authorDaniel Dunbar <daniel@zuster.org>2009-11-14 03:23:19 +0000
committerDaniel Dunbar <daniel@zuster.org>2009-11-14 03:23:19 +0000
commit348185548eb23fe818255f72da5edfb9e5b2c9ce (patch)
tree31da6a66bb205c3ab38ef81329bff1b2043c7ff1 /llvm/lib/CodeGen/MachineFunctionAnalysis.cpp
parent654e5c7cf802af8b04106bcf6852654fc80144eb (diff)
downloadbcm5719-llvm-348185548eb23fe818255f72da5edfb9e5b2c9ce.tar.gz
bcm5719-llvm-348185548eb23fe818255f72da5edfb9e5b2c9ce.zip
Add VerifyDiagnosticsClient, to replace old -verify.
- This reimplements -verify as just another DiagnosticClient, which buffers the diagnostics and checks them when the source file is complete. There are some hacks to make this work, but they are all internal, and this exposes a better external interface. - This also tweaks a few things: o Errors are now just regular diagnostics. o Frontend diagnostics are now caught (for example, errors in command line arguments), although there isn't yet a way to specify that they are expected. That would be nice though. - Not yet used. llvm-svn: 88748
Diffstat (limited to 'llvm/lib/CodeGen/MachineFunctionAnalysis.cpp')
0 files changed, 0 insertions, 0 deletions
OpenPOWER on IntegriCloud